“There’s a yank on the phone. He wants me to go over [to the States] and kick that God darn ball.”
- John Smith to his girlfriend (now wife)
You’ve heard him talk about the Snowplow Game. Now, we speak with John Smith about his life & career.
How did a promising, young soccer player in England become a Pro Bowl, American football player for the Patriots?
He answers all of the following and more: What was his initial interaction with Coach Fairbanks like? What did Howard Cosell say about his first kickoff? How did John get around his rookie “hazing”? Later in his career, he became forever linked with Cosell over what tragedy? What are John’s thoughts on ‘Ted Lasso’? What’s it like kicking a game winning field goal? What are his fondest thoughts of regarding his time with the Patriots? What did he absolutely love to do after retirement from football?
And you’re going to love his stories about his first field goal and his great friend, Steve Grogan.
